To use a projector with your V30 phone, you will need a compatible projector and a compatible cable to connect your phone to the projector. Here are the steps to connect your V30 phone to a projector:

1. Make sure your projector and V30 phone are turned off.
2. Locate the HDMI or USB port on your projector and plug in the corresponding cable.
3. Connect the other end of the cable to your V30 phone (use a USB C to HDMI adapter if needed).
4. Turn on your projector and set it to the correct input source.
5. Turn on your V30 phone and wait for it to recognize the projector.
6. Follow the prompts on your phone to allow screen sharing and adjust the settings as needed (such as resolution and aspect ratio).
7. Use your phone to navigate and display what you want to project on the screen.

Note: if your projector and phone dont have a compatible port, you can try using a wireless streaming device such as a Miracast or Chromecast to cast your phones screen to the projector wirelessly.

How to Connect Your V30 Phone to a Projector: A Step-by-Step Guide

With the ever-increasing demands of the digital age, having a powerful smartphone like the LG V30 has become a necessity. However, when it comes to displaying content to a group of people, the small screen of a smartphone can be a hindrance. Luckily, you can connect your V30 phone to a projector and enjoy a larger image for presentations, movies, or even gaming. Heres how to do it in a few simple steps.

Step 1: Get the right adapter
Before you can connect your V30 phone to a projector, you need to get the right adapter. The easiest and most reliable way to do this is to use a USB-C to HDMI adapter. You can buy these adapters from online retailers like Amazon or at your local electronics store.

Step 2: Connect your adapter to the projector
Plug one end of the HDMI cable into the USB-C to HDMI adapter, and the other end into the HDMI port on your projector. Make sure your projector is switched on and set to the right input source.

Step 3: Connect the adapter to your phone
Plug the USB-C end of the adapter into your V30 phone. Depending on the adapter you have chosen, you may need to power it through a separate USB port on your phone or a power outlet.

Step 4: Select the right input source on your phone
Once you have connected everything correctly, your phone should automatically recognize the projector and display the image on the large screen. If it doesnt, go to your phones settings and select "Display" and then "Cast." From there, you should see the option to "Cast screen" or "Wireless display."

Step 5: Adjust the image
If the image doesnt fit perfectly on your projector screen, you can adjust it by going into the "Display" settings on your phone and changing the resolution or aspect ratio. To avoid lag or video buffering, its best to set your phones resolution to match the resolution of your projector.

Connecting a Projector to an AV Receiver: A Beginners Guide

Are you looking to set up a home theater system with your projector and AV receiver? If youre new to the world of audiovisual equipment, this may seem like a daunting task. However, with a bit of guidance, youll soon have your projector and receiver working together seamlessly.

To begin with, lets understand the purpose of an AV receiver. An AV receiver is the central hub that powers, governs and connects all of the audio and video components in your home theater system. This means that, among other things, the receiver takes care of routing audio and visual signals to a compatible output device, such as a TV, projector or speakers.

The first step towards connecting your projector to an AV receiver is to ensure that both devices are compatible with each other. Check the user manuals of both the projector and receiver to ascertain whether they have compatible ports and connectors. Generally, modern projectors and AV receivers use HDMI, which is the most straightforward and convenient way to connect them.

To set up the connection, locate the HDMI output port on the AV receiver and connect an HDMI cable to it. Next, connect the other end of the HDMI cable to the HDMI input port of your projector. Most modern projectors have multiple HDMI ports, so make sure you use the appropriate port.

With the HDMI connection in place, you should now see the AV receivers interface appear on your projectors screen. Follow the receivers manual to set up the audio and video output from the receiver to the projector. This may involve selecting the correct input source and adjusting the audio settings, such as speaker configuration, volume levels and sound modes.

Another important aspect to consider is the remote control. Ensure that the AV receivers remote has an unobstructed line of sight with the receiver itself. If you dont have a clear line of sight, consider investing in an infrared (IR) extender to allow the remote to work even if its out of line of sight.

Finally, test your home theater system thoroughly to ensure that everything is working as expected. Play a few movies or TV shows and check the picture quality, sound quality and synchronization between audio and video. If you encounter any issues, refer back to the manuals and troubleshooting guides to resolve them.
